Abba Kyari's Co-Defendants Sentence To Two-Year Imprisonment
Justice Emeka Nwite of a Federal High Court sitting in Abuja has sentenced two co-defendants of the suspended Deputy Commissioner of Police (DCP) Abba Kyari to two years' imprisonment.

The judgment, which was delivered on Tuesday noted that having admitted to committing the offence preferred against them in counts 5, 6 and 7 by the NDLEA, Chibunna Umeibe and Emeka Ezenwanne, who are 6th and 7th defendants, "are thereby found guilty and convicted accordingly."

Recall that the National Drug Law Enforcement Agency (NDLEA) had filed a suit against the duo over alleged cocaine deal after they were arrested at the Akanu Ibiam International Airport in Enugu by the Nigerian Police and handed over to them for drug trafficking.

During the trial they pleaded guilty to five, six and seven counts preferred against them by the anti-narcotic agency and prayed for a plea bargain before the court.

This was stated by counsel for the NDLEA, Sunday Joseph who revealed that two motions dated June 13, were filed on June 14, seeking a plea bargain in respect of Umeibe and Ezenwanne.

The lawyer of the two defendants, E. U. Okenyi, also concurred with Joseph's submission.
